"We started out making a film about Hollywood royalty," directors Alexis Bloom and Fisher Stevens told People magazine. "And we ended up making a film about love."

The documentary was filmed from 2014 to 2015 and includes home movies from the family. "Bright Lights" will air Jan. 7 on HBO.
